Analysis of Entry Point AI

Overall verdict

  • Entry Point AI is a solid, user-friendly platform for fine-tuning language models, making custom AI model training accessible to teams without deep machine learning expertise. It streamlines dataset management, training, and evaluation across multiple providers, offering good value for those looking to build specialized models.

Why this product is good

  • Provides an intuitive, no-code/low-code interface for fine-tuning LLMs, lowering the barrier to entry for non-experts
  • Supports multiple model providers (like OpenAI, Cohere, and open-source models), giving flexibility and avoiding vendor lock-in
  • Includes helpful tools for managing training datasets, organizing examples, and evaluating model performance
  • Saves significant time compared to building custom fine-tuning pipelines from scratch
  • Good educational resources and documentation to help users understand fine-tuning best practices
